程序员发程序可以通过以下几种方法:
使用蓝奏云
准备材料:网络、蓝奏云网站地址(https://www.lanzou.com/)、蓝奏云网盘账号。
登录蓝奏云,创建文件夹并上传项目文件。
可以通过设置访问密码和生成外链分享地址来分享文件。
使用压缩文件
将程序文件打包成压缩文件(如zip或rar),并通过电子邮件、社交媒体或文件共享服务发送给朋友。
使用代码托管平台
将程序上传到代码托管平台(如GitHub),然后分享程序的链接给朋友。
使用文件传输工具
使用FTP或云存储服务(如百度网盘)将程序上传到特定位置,并发送共享链接。
分割文件
将大文件分割成多个较小的文件进行传输,接收方可以将这些文件重新合并为原始的大文件。
压缩文件
在发送前,将大文件进行压缩,减小文件大小,从而减少传输时间和网络带宽的占用。常用的压缩方法包括zip、gzip或tar等。
使用流式传输
通过使用流式传输,可以实现边读取文件边传输的功能,适用于网络带宽较低或传输距离较远的情况。
使用分布式文件系统
如果大文件需要在多个节点之间传输,可以使用分布式文件系统,如Hadoop的HDFS或Google的GFS。
使用断点续传
在传输大文件时,可以使用断点续传的方法,即在传输过程中记录已传输的部分,当连接恢复时,可以从上次中断的地方继续传输。
特定平台发布
如果程序是MATLAB代码,可以通过创建格式化文档并发布。
对于微信小程序,需要提交代码到微信公众平台进行审核,配置基本信息和服务器域名,然后发布上线。
后端程序如果是jar包形式,可以在目标机器上安装必要的第三方工具后执行启动服务。
根据具体情况选择合适的方法,可以确保程序文件能够顺利地发送给他人。